Module Costlib__CostInstantiate

module Call : sig ... end
type 'a interproc_analysis = (BO.BufferOverrunAnalysisSummary.t option * 'a * Costlib.CostDomain.summary option) Absint.InterproceduralAnalysis.t
type instantiated_cost =
| Cheap
| NoModel
| Symbolic of Costlib.CostDomain.BasicCost.t
val get_cost_if_expensive : 'a interproc_analysis -> Call.t -> Costlib.CostDomain.BasicCost.t option
val get_instantiated_cost : 'a interproc_analysis -> Call.t -> instantiated_cost